The “revised” Eclipse is great
I’ve been in the Eclipse several times, the last being Jan 2025. The ship was in dry dock between then and now, and improvements go beyond the expected. The grass on either side of the sunset bar is gone. In its place, there are now comfortable chairs and more shade. Finding a place to sit is no longer a problem, especially when it’s crowded, like at a sail away. The grass near the glass blowing area is still there. There’s no longer an Ilounge, but tech help is still available. I’m not sure what happened in the galleys, but the food in the MDR has improved considerably. We generally do specialty dining 4 or 5 times on a cruise of this length, but only went twice as the MDR offerings were good. Finally, a weird sort of transition has gone on with staff and crew. They all seemed much more personable. The service staff In the MDR were fantastic, and hysterical. The bartenders seemed less harried, too. I honestly believe it impacted The passengers. The vibe was very chill, which is what I look for when I cruise. I don’t do a lot of activities or go to shows, but people really spoke highly of their experiences. People who like noisy nighttime stuff will be happy. As far as the itinerary goes, the ports were amazing. I checked a lot of items off my bucket list. We used third party tours at all ports. Overall, one of the best cruises I’ve been on.

Phenomenal NIGHT GREECE, ITALY & CROATIA CRUISE
This cruise was a perfect sampling of the Mediterranean. Stopping in ports for cities that had their own unique offerings. Each location was beautiful, and provided its own special memories. If I could design the perfect cruise, the only thing I would change here is the amount of time in each port. Some cities have so much to offer that you cannot do nearly as much as you would like. It would be awesome if Rome for example, could be two days. On board the ship, the overall experience was exceptional. We had a balcony cabin, and the only thing I would change, is where the electrical outlets are located. There was one in the bathroom, and all of the rest were at a desk. I would assume most people charge their phones overnight, and would prefer to have them near the bed. Throughout the ship the service was excellent. The staff was always friendly, and very accommodating. Overall a fantastic experience. I would consider doing this same cruise again.
